When the Pakistan Super League began early this month, Islamabad United led by Misbahul Haque looked confirmed and ‘emphatic’ underdogs. The hype created around the Karachi Tigers infact made all other teams look dismally hopeless. But soon Quetta Gladiators and Peshawar Zalmi began to steal all limelight. Till Islamabad United suddenly changed gear and went on to the winning ways, all speculation was focused on whether Quetta or Peshawar would lift the first trophy.
Cricket has once again proved that it is a game of glorious uncertainties. Lahore Qalandars could not win a key match even after posting the first 200plus score. And yesterday Quetta after looking like posting over 200 runs, slumped to 174 which too was an impressive score. But Islamabad United once again looked ruthlessly efficient.
Misbahul Haque’s team has lifted the first trophy of the PSL—and certainly not undeservedly. They have beaten all other competing teams— and in a row.
